This dataset includes building characteristics, panel capacity, and avaliable breaker space for single-family homes aggregated from field data collected by the TECH Clean California program, the Northwest Energy Efficiency Residential Building Stock Assessment, Home Energy Analytics, the Bay Area Renewable Energy Network, the Minnesota Center for Energy and Environment, the Berkeley Lab Citizen Science Survey, and the California Public Utilities Commission.
, We standardized categorical field values in our dataset to account for variation in naming conventions across our datasets (e.g. âheat pumpâ and âHPâ). We also excluded outlier panel capacity values. We also screened out panel capacities that we suspected were data entry errors due their being unique to the dataset, non-integer, or not divisible by five. . We further excluded homes with panel capacities that were non-integer or not divisible by five as they did not agree with our understanding of electrical panel sizing. Additionally, we removed three homes less than 1,500 ft2 that had 10,000A panels, which we considered unrealistic. ## Description of the data and file structure
This file contains data on building characteristics in single-family homes from multiple field data sources. The characteristics include: the year/decade of construction; primary fuels for space and water heating; cooking, and clothes drying; electrical panel capacity; available breaker spaces in the electrical panel; the presence of PV; the type and presence of cooling technologies; and the number of major electrical loads.Â
